Basic Body Parts

Major Body Parts Vocabulary

SpanishEnglishExample Sentence
la cabezathe headMe duele la cabeza
el brazothe armTengo el brazo lastimado
la piernathe legCamino con la pierna
la manothe handEscribo con la mano
el piethe footMe duele el pie
la espaldathe backTengo dolor de espalda

DELE A1 Tip: Use “me duele” for singular body parts and “me duelen” for plural. For example: “me duele la cabeza” but “me duelen los pies.”

Body Parts with Articles

Using Definite Articles

Body PartWith ArticleExample
cabezala cabezaMe duele la cabeza
ojoslos ojosMe duelen los ojos
manola manoTengo la mano herida
pieslos piesMe duelen los pies

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Wrong verb: ❌ “soy dolor” ✅ “tengo dolor
  • Incorrect article: ❌ “me duele cabeza” ✅ “me duele la cabeza
  • Wrong plural: ❌ “me duele los pies” ✅ “me duelen los pies
